Sleeping on a Train: A Guide to Comfort and Relaxation
Train travel presents a unique opportunity for a comfortable and relaxing sleep experience. The rhythmic motion of the train can gently rock you into slumber, while the steady hum creates a soothing ambiance. With a little preparation, you can make the most of your train journey by ensuring a restful night’s sleep.
Comfort Techniques:
- Pack a cozy blanket: A soft and warm blanket will provide an extra layer of comfort and help you stay snug during the night.
- Bring an eye mask: An eye mask will block out any light, allowing you to sleep undisturbed in the dimly lit train carriage.
- Consider earplugs: Earplugs can minimize noise from other passengers or train announcements, ensuring a peaceful sleep.
- Choose a comfortable seat: If possible, select a seat that offers ample legroom and a good view. This will prevent you from feeling cramped or uncomfortable.
Sleep Aids:
- Melatonin: This natural sleep aid can help regulate your body’s circadian rhythm and promote relaxation.
- Lavender oil: The calming scent of lavender can promote relaxation and ease sleep. You can diffuse it in your seat or apply it to your temples.
- White noise: A white noise machine or app can provide a soothing background sound that can block out distractions and help you fall asleep.
Additional Tips:
- Pack light: Avoid bringing too much luggage that can take up valuable space and make it difficult to sleep comfortably.
- Dress in layers: Train temperatures can fluctuate, so it’s best to dress in layers so you can adjust as needed.
- Stay hydrated: Drink plenty of water before and during your train journey to prevent dehydration and improve sleep quality.
- Avoid caffeine and alcohol: Caffeine and alcohol can interfere with sleep, so it’s best to limit your intake before bed.
By following these tips, you can maximize the comfort and relaxation of sleeping on a train. Whether you’re embarking on a long-haul journey or a short overnight trip, a good night’s rest will ensure that you arrive at your destination refreshed and rejuvenated.
